Banks to Lobby for Stablecoin Yield in 18 Months, Says Adrian Wall

Justin Sun, founder of TRON and advisor to crypto exchange HTX, has flagged a prediction from Adrian Wall that banks will seek stablecoin yield within 18 months. This forecast comes after the CLARITY Act compromise stripped the provision for stablecoin yield.

The move follows the stablecoin yield war that reshaped bank tolerance for the legislation. According to Sun, this development is closely watched by Bitcoin and broader crypto market participants due to its implications on regulatory shifts.

Sun highlighted Adrian Wall's forecast, citing his prediction that banks will return to Capitol Hill within 18 months to demand yield on idle stablecoins. This shift in bank behavior may indicate a change in their stance on digital assets regulation.
